Table 1 Extended unified theory of acceptance and use of technology survey questionnaire and mean scores

From: Applying the UTAUT2 framework to patients’ attitudes toward healthcare task shifting with artificial intelligence

Item

Mean score ± SD

PE1. The AI-novice echocardiogram will give an accurate risk stratification of my cardiac condition.

3.78 ± 0.73

PE2. The AI-novice echocardiogram will enable a more efficient clinic consult

3.87 ± 0.74

PE3. I trust the results of the AI-novice echocardiogram.

3.71 ± 0.75

PE4. The results of the AI-novice echocardiogram will give me reassurance when it is normal

3.96 ± 0.65

PE5. I trust the healthcare staff performing the AI-novice echocardiogram screening on me

4.14 ± 0.58

EE1. It would not take the healthcare staff long to learn how to use AI-novice echocardiogram

3.79 ± 0.79

EE2. The AI-novice echocardiogram would be easy to learn

3.80 ± 0.79

EE3. It would be easy for the healthcare staff to become skillful at using the AI-novice echocardiogram even when they do not have ultrasound training

3.79 ± 0.78

EE4. Performing the AI-novice echocardiogram on me should be easy

3.91 ± 0.66

SI1. People who are important to me think that I should use the AI-novice echocardiogram before clinic visit

3.67 ± 0.72

SI2. People whose opinions I value would like me to use the AI-novice echocardiogram

3.69 ± 0.70

FC1. The healthcare workers have the knowledge necessary to use the AI-novice echocardiogram

4.06 ± 0.64

FC2. The AI-novice echocardiogram device is similar to other screening tools such as the electrocardiogram, retinal eye screening etc.

3.73 ± 0.87

FC3. The novice has the resources necessary to perform the AI-novice echocardiogram.

3.97 ± 0.61

HM1. The process of screening via the AI-novice echocardiogram is enjoyable

3.65 ± 0.70

HM2 The process of screening via the AI-novice echocardiogram is fun

3.59 ± 0.88

BI1. I intend to be a frequent user of AI-enabled screening devices

3.60 ± 0.81

BI2. I intend to continue using AI-screening devices in future

3.72 ± 0.72
